One pundit compared it to the Tet offensive. North Vietnam pushed the Viet Cong to attack and then watched as they were destroyed as a fighting force. That left the NVA to run the war.

I see other issues at play:

1. Israel is expending a lot of fuel and ammo already.

2. Jets are not like cars, they require periodic inspections and certain components only have a specific life span (in flight hours) before they require changing.

3. 300,000 recalled Reservists is going to be a major strain on the Israeli economy. The land war will start soon because Israel cannot keep that many people on active duty for a long period of time.

4. The strain on the Israel military may weaken it as a fighting force even over the short term. It may leave Israel vulnerable. A month from now if this is still going on, I would be worried that Hezbollah and foreign Islamists will begin coordinated attacks on Israel via the West Bank and Lebanon.

5. While Israel is busy killing off Hamas, Iran is free to finish its nuclear weapons program.

Gaza is relatively small and a target rich environment. Israel may not need a long protracted fight to clear out Hamas. One possible miscalculation on Hamas' part would be the total war Israel is launching. Hamas may have thought based on Israel's previous responses and the large number of hostages that Israel would hit Gaza, vent their revenge and then negotiate for the hostages. It appears from the outside looking in that the Israeli leadership has written off at least the adult hostages and there will be total war. I am sure in Israel, smarter people than me have already discussed this attack being a feint to divert Israel's attention before a larger attack from the North and West begins.
